Does hot object have high kinetic energy?

Hotter objects have a higher average kinetic energy and a higher temperature; cooler objects have a lower average kinetic energy and a lower temperature. The atoms, molecules, and ions in objects have a range of speeds and kinetic energies: some are moving faster and others are moving slower.

Do hot or cold objects have more kinetic energy?

The faster they move, the more kinetic energy they have. When an object is hot, the particles move faster. As it cools, the particles move more slowly. Particles move faster in hot objects than in cooler objects.

What happens to average kinetic energy when heated?

As stated in the kinetic-molecular theory, the temperature of a substance is related to the average kinetic energy of the particles of that substance. When a substance is heated, some of the absorbed energy is stored within the particles, while some of the energy increases the motion of the particles.

What happens to kinetic energy during melting?

As ice melts into water, kinetic energy is being added to the particles. This causes them to be ‘excited’ and they break the bonds that hold them together as a solid, resulting in a change of state: solid -> liquid.

Can a hot object weigh more than a cold one?

Answer by Frank Heile, Physicist, Software Engineer, Consciousness Theory. Yes. If you have absolutely identical objects that have the same weight exactly when they are at the same temperature, then when one object is heated, it will weigh more.
